Vinyl siding can expand and contract due to environmental temperature changes as well as different exposure to sunlight and shade. This can cause the paint to peel off faster. When you decide to paint your vinyl siding you must use the right type of paint.
Vinyl siding expands and contracts with temperature and darker colors absorb more heat than the siding is designed to hold. Painting vinyl siding starts with choosing the color and the paint. Use a very high grade of vinyl siding paint. Vinyl siding and shutters do not need to be primed as long as you use the appropriate paint.

In other words painting vinyl siding requires a latex urethane paint formulated for exterior use. A fresh coat of paint no matter what type of siding you have ensures the high value investment called home always looks its best. Be sure to inspect and confirm your vinyl is properly installed. Due to this the proper type of paint to use when painting vinyl siding is one that is a blend of urethane and acrylic resins.
